Hong Kong Disneyland’s Toy Story & Pixar Pals Summer Splash runs from June 26 to September 1, 2019, featuring an upgraded Pixar Water Play Street Party, Toy Story 4 characters, and a huge selection of food and merchandise. This summer, Hong Kong Disneyland will also open its new Bibbidi Bobbidi Boutique, the Nemo Recreation Reef at Disney Explorers Lodge, and offer a new Moana room overlay, too. Check out the Hong Kong Disneyland Events Calendar 2019 for more on the events, entertainment, and merchandise coming to the Park this year. Pixar Water Play Street Party Pixar characters parade down Main Street helping guests keep cool with a healthy dose of water. The Pixar Water Play Street Party debuted in 2018 and is back with two new floats, new characters, and over 40 performers. Bo Peep in her new Toy Story 4 outfit and new character Forky will join the party, along with other Toy Story Characters, the Incredibles, Carl, Russel and Dug from Up, and Joy and Sadness from Inside Out. The new Toy Story and Finding Nemo floats might look familiar because they are originally from the Happiness is Here parade, which ended at Toyko Disneyland in 2018. It’s great to see these floats make a return and they will fit right in with the party’s Pixar theme. Toy Story & Pixar Pals Summer Splash also includes Character greetings Bo Peep in her new Toy Story 4 jumpsuit Mr. Incredible, Elastigirl, Frozone, and Edna Mode from The Incredibles Over 280 new merchandise items! Disneyland Hong Kong is a fairly small but popular theme park attracting about 8 million visitors a year as of 2019, and they are adding new facilities. It can get highly crowded, lines can get long, and it is a complex park. It can be confusing to navigate and know how to optimize your visit. We at China Highlights want you to enjoy your trip, so we've put together some touring information, tips, and suggestions to help you have a great memorable day in one of Hong Kong's most popular theme parks. What Is Disneyland Hong Kong? Hong Kong Disneyland Park Thrill rides and Disney-themed buildings cover square kilometers 320 acres of hill and coast on the far eastern side of Lantau Island, and it is conveniently close to Hong Kong International Airport. It has modern world-class thrill rides and 3 luxury hotels to choose from. It's small size makes it generally suitable for a day visit, so unless you wish to have an overnight stay in one of their luxury hotels, it isn't necessary to get a ticket for more than a day. Thrill rides The park's main attractions for adults and most children are the roller coasters and thrill rides. It is the smallest of the world's Disneyland resorts. It has the California Disneyland design including Sleeping Beauty Castle. Three large luxury hotel/resorts take up substantial space and are three of the main attractions. Overall, it is a special attraction for children, but adults as well might enjoy the performances and shows, entertainment facilities, souvenir shops, and restaurants in a scenic hillside and ocean setting. What are Disneyland's Highlights? For your visit, we recommend seeing these highlights and doing these things as priorities in this order in a day tour Big Grizzly Mountain Coaster Space Mountain Ironman Experience Show for entertainment Festival of the Lion King Our Suggested Disneyland Hong Kong Day Tour Plan Here we detail some tips and suggestions for having an optimal one-day Hong Kong Disneyland tour. In general, try to ride the most popular rides that interest you before the pushy crowds arrive around lunchtime, and in the afternoon, leisurely see the shows, entertainments and other park attractions. Arrival Get there early and when it isn't busy The Chinese crowds arrive about two hours after the park opens. Opening is 1000 or 1030 am most days, but may vary on holidays. So to avoid the lines and the push crowds, try to be there before the park opens and definitely avoid the busy holidays and weekends. Try to purchase your tickets directly online or through agents before you go. Transport For public transport, we recommend taking the MTR to Disneyland Station. You'll get the added bonus of a Disney decorated train to the station. The transfer station is the Sunny Bay Station. From there, it takes about 5 minutes to Disneyland Resort Station. Trains are frequent every 5 minutes during peak hours and every 10 minutes otherwise. However, taxis from Central are relatively quick. See the Transport information below. Get an Octopus card Hong Kong is fairly unique in the world because you can purchase a card that you can swipe to pay for MTR and bus fares, and it might also be used to pay for many other things such as purchases at supermarkets, convenience stores, and restaurants. The card allows people to travel without standing in line to buy tickets. Cardholders simply swipe their cards and their fares are deducted electronically. You can buy these at the MTR station ticket windows and then use them for more convenience to pay for things in the park. No ID is required to buy one, and you can add money as you wish and return the card to a station window for some money back. What Is the Layout of Disneyland Hong Kong? — 7 Theme Areas Disneyland is divided into seven distinct theme areas that are designed so that visitors can't see or hear the other areas in the area that they are in. The idea is to make visitors feel they are entering and leaving different worlds as they traverse the theme areas. 1. Main Street, USA On Main Street, USA, you can enjoy the typical old architectures from America and all kinds of classic antique cars, as well as taste the delicious food from both Western and Eastern countries. 2. Adventureland In Adventureland, traveling along several wide rivers, through the extensive African grassland, in the mysterious Asian forest, and across Taishan Island, a brave pilot will lead you to explore the wonders and secret, remote scenes that nature has to offer. 3. Grizzly Gulch The themed land resembles an abandoned mining town called "Grizzly Gulch", set amidst mountains and woods. You can dash in and out of twisting caverns and rumble through Grizzly Gulch aboard a speeding mine train. 4. Mystic Point It is set in 1909 at an adventurer's outpost that was established in 1896 in a dense, uncharted rain forest surrounded by mysterious forces and supernatural events. The site features Mystic Manor, the home of Lord Henry Mystic – a world traveler and adventurer – and his mischievous monkey, Albert. 5. Toy Story Land Toy Story Land is themed using bamboo to act as giant blades of grass surrounding the area. You can meet and greet some of your favorite toys from the Toy Story movies. 6. Fantasyland Fantasyland is a fairy-tale world full of happiness from your dreams, featuring the beautiful and kindhearted Snow White, lively little flying elephants, and cute and naive little Winnie Bears — all the characters from tales that give you happiness and pleasure. 7. Tomorrowland In Tomorrowland, you can experience a thrilling trip in outer space and explore the endless universes. Hong Kong Disneyland Luxury Hotel Resorts and Parkland Hong Kong Disneyland Castle At the 5-star Hong Kong Disneyland Park Hotel and the 4-star Disneyland Hollywood Hotel, you can enjoy both the fairy-tale world and movie world and be surprised by Disney characters here and there. The 4-star Disney Explorers Hotel is the newest and biggest hotel there, and it is 1920s and exploration themed. The Inspiration Lake Resort Center is a reservoir and public park area that is managed by Disneyland. It is free and open to the public daily from 900 am to 700 pm. You can go there for strolls in the park, to exercise, and for fun on the water. Travel Tips and Essentials for Planning a Trip The Best Time for a Visit Hong Kong Disneyland Park October, November, and December are good months for a visit to Disneyland. It is usually warm and dry in Hong Kong until around the end of December or early January. You are recommended to avoid China's National Day October 1st to 7th when a large number of tourists go there from Mainland China. Hours Generally 1000 am or 1030 am to 800 pm or 900 pm. Check their web information for the precise times for the day you want to visit. During holidays, the park hours vary. Getting Tickets and Prices in 2019 Getting tickets directly at the gate generally costs more than getting them online through Klook. You can see below that two-day tickets are cheaper per day. These two-day tickets can be for a second day within 7 days after your first visit and not necessarily on two consecutive days. Staying at the hotel ticket discounts If you book at one of the three Disneyland hotels, you can get a price discount on tickets. Then getting a two-day ticket makes sense. Recommended stay However, the park is so small that a day visit is optimal for most people. Ticket General Admission ages 12–64 Child ages 3–11 Senior ages 65+ 1-Day HK$ 619 about 79 USD HK$ 458 58 USD HK$ 100 about 13 USD 2-Day HK$ 799 about 102 USD HK$ 589 75 USD HK$ 170 22 USD Transportation — How to Get to Disneyland Transportation Location It occupies the far eastern part of Lantau Island. It is about 12 kilometers away from Hong Kong International Airport. Mass Transit Railway MTR You can take the special Disneyland line to go to Disneyland Resort Station. It takes about 14 minutes to get from Sunny Bay Station to Hong Kong Disneyland including a 9 minute walk. Passengers taking the Airport Express can access the Disneyland resort by changing to the Tung Chung line at Tsing Yi Station. Then, transfer at Sunny Bay Station for the Disneyland Resort line. Taxi From Central, taxis go to Disneyland in about 27 minutes and prices start at about 40 USD. Our family loves theme parks so we’ve been to many theme parks all over the world. Of all the theme parks we’ve been to, Hong Kong Disneyland has been the single most relaxed experience we’ve ever think we were more relaxed because the park is smaller in size than many theme parks and the average daily attendance is also lower than the other four Disneyland parks. This means that the off-peak periods are generally quieter than other Disney theme parks and even the peak periods are less brutal. Some theme parks we’ve experienced have queues of 2-3 hours for the most popular rides, while at Hong Kong Disneyland queues of 1 hour or more for the major rides are uncommon.ⓘ FUN FACT Hong Kong Disneyland is the smallest of the five Disneyland Parks in the world by size, crowd capacity and annual attendance. It is physically the smallest Disneyland Park in the world. For example, Hong Kong Disneyland is about 68 acres compared to Tokyo Disneyland which is 115 acres in size. The maximum capacity of Hong Kong Disneyland is about 42 000 people at any one time while Tokyo Disneyland’s maximum capacity is about 85 000 people. We had originally intended to stay at Explorers Lodge but they didn’t offer a single room that could accommodate a family of five like oursClick here to book Disney Explorers Lodge through KlookDisneyland Hong Kong Opening HoursThe opening hours for Hong Kong Disneyland can vary almost on a daily basis. For example, as I write this article, in November 2018 the earliest opening time is 10 am and the latest closing time is 9 pm. The December opening hours are in a similar range while in January 2019 the park closes a little earlier sometimes closing as early as 730 pm. Main Street USA opens about 30 minutes before the rest of the park best advice is to check the Hong Kong Disneyland park calendar for the date/s you are planning to visit the Time to visit Hong Kong DisneylandWhen planning a visit to Hong Kong Disneyland, weather and crowds are the two main factors to consider. Broadly speaking, Summer is a good time to avoid due to a combination of more difficult weather conditions and larger crowds. It’s also a good idea to avoid weekends, public holidays and longer holiday periods where possible due to higher crowd numbers. However, generally crowds aren’t as bad as many bigger theme parks even in peak periods.ⓘ TIP When planning a visit to Hong Kong Disneyland I would highly recommend downloading the official Hong Kong Disneyland mobile app to get a sense of wait times for rides and other attractions before you actually visit. It’s also great to use the app when visiting the park to check wait times, so you can plan your day. The app also has a built-in GPS-enabled map, provides show schedules, helps locate Disney characters and it also provides 1-tap calling to make restaurant reservations. Click on this link to download the mobile is a more detailed look at the best times to visit Hong Kong Disneyland. Personally, I think Winter, Spring and Autumn are all good seasons to visit Hong Kong temperatures are mild with average monthly high temperatures from 18°C to 20°C / 64°F to 68°F. The chance of rainfall is also lower. Winter is also the second lowest tourist period for Hong Kong. However, the period leading up to Christmas is a popular time to visit the park. Chinese New Year which normally falls in January or February and goes for 15 days might also be a good time to avoid Hong Kong Disneyland as many locals will be visiting. The period leading up to Chinese New Year is a good time to visit particularly the week before when decorations are in place as is the period following Chinese New and AutumnSpring and Autumn are also good times to visit in terms of weather as average high temperatures are moderate compared to Summer with Spring average high temperatures from 21°C to 28°C / 70°F to 82°F. Autumn average high temperatures from 24°C to 30°C / 75°F to 86° visited the park on a Monday in mid-Autumn and found the weather pleasant and the crowds low, making it for us a great time to visit Hong Kong Disneyland. It was also a fun time to visit as Halloween festivities were downside of Spring and Autumn are that these are the two busiest tourist seasons. This means that hotels will be more expensive in this period. In 2019, the legal holiday for National Day runs for 3 days in mainland China 2 days in Macau and 1 day in Hong Kong. This creates a National Day Golden Week which runs from October 1 to October 7 in 2019. Hong Kong Disneyland is likely to be very busy during this is probably the most difficult time to visit Hong Kong Disneyland. The weather conditions from June to September are more savage due to the combination of higher temperatures the average above 30°C / 86°F and high humidity. The chance of rain is also highest from May through August. May to September is also typhoon season in Hong mid-June to mid-August students are also on their summer holiday and many of them will go to Hong Kong Disneyland although attendance will be somewhat spread out through the week and weekend. Being tall enough to go on some of the more extreme theme park rides in Australia and overseas has almost been a rite of passage’ for our children as they have grown up. For example, they were all very excited when they got to 140 cm 4 foot 6 inches in height so they could go on the Green Lantern at Movie World on the Gold Coast. In contrast, the most restrictive height limit at Disneyland Hong Kong is the RC Racer in Toy Story Land with a minimum height of 120 cm about 4 foot. If you want your kids to become part of the show, don’t forget to register in Knights in TrainingThe Hong Kong Disneyland FastpassA Fastpass is a special ticket which allows you to jump the regular queues and enter a ride through a special and much shorter Hong Kong Disneyland Fastpass is a free service that comes as part of your entrance ticket but is only available for three of the most popular rides at Hong Kong Disneyland Iron Man Experience, Hyperspace Mountain, and Adventures of Winnie the some of the other more popular rides and experiences such Big Grizzly Mountain Runaway Mine Cars, Mystic Manor and Festival of the Lion King are not covered by the Fastpass get Fastpasses from special dispensing machines located at the entrance area for these three rides. You must have your regular entrance ticket when collected Fastpasses and each person in your group must get a Fastpass for the ride. When you receive a ticket, you will be given an allotted time period of one hour to return to the ride. At any one time, you can only have one active Kong Disneyland Priority PassWhen staying at Hong Kong Disney hotels there is a similar but even more flexible service available to we stayed at Hong Kong Disneyland Hotel we received priority admission passes for all five members of our family. This pass gave priority entry to Mickey’s PhilharMagic, Mystic Manor, Hyperspace Mountain, Big Grizzly Mountain Runaway Mine Cars, and the Iron Man Experience. As I’ve mentioned earlier, this show was for us almost worth the cost of admission on its of the Lion KingHong Kong Disneyland with KidsHong Kong Disneyland is a very kid-friendly theme park. Here are the reasons whyFirst, it’s smaller than most theme parks which means less the crowds are smaller meaning the queues are not as long across the board. This means that your children will become less bored and most rides are accessible for younger children. For example, the minimum height for Hyperspace Mountain is 102 cm 3 ft 3 inches, Iron Man Experience is 102 cm 3 foot 3 inches, Big Grizzly Mountain Runaway Mine Cars is 112 cm 3 ft 7 inches, Toy Soldier Parachute Drop is 81 cm 2 ft 6 inches and for Mystic Manor riders can be any height. The most restrictive ride is RC Racer where the minimum height is 120 cm 9 3 ft 9 inches.Fourth, they offer a rider switch service which allows adults to take turns waiting with children that are unable to go on certain rides. Note that only two people are allowed per rider the park is stroller friendly. The park is flat and there are plenty of places to park your pram. You can also hire a pram Hong Kong Disneyland has a baby care centre which includes a comfortable nursing room, a napper/diaper changing area, and highchairs upon request. The care centre also has a refrigerator, microwave facilities and hot water. There are also 6 companion restrooms throughout the park for parents and children to use togetherTwo other tips for families and kids are to collect stickers and to collect and trade Disney pins. Most Disneyland Hong Kong cast members carry stickers and there are plenty of cool stickers to collect. Don’t be shy in asking cast members what stickers they have.
